We are not using discovery but want to begin inputing our Configuration items. We are 90% Vmware and want to enter each of our virtual machines (Windows and Linux virtual servers) into the CMDB. If we add them under the Windows Server class it wants asset and serial number information which a virtual machine doesn't have. it also then creates a blank asset record. If we add them as a Vmware Virtual Instance it doesn't ask for Operation system and other important information. Is there a way we should do this out of the box or are we going to have to customize the CI classes?
